What to look for while buying horse equipment?

When it comes to buying equipment for your horse, it is important to understand what all you can buy for your horse to beautify and make it feel more comfortable. It is also important to match the horse accessory/ equipment with the size and nature of the species of horse you own.

Generally speaking, you may like to buy saddle, corrective pads and girth sleeves, to name a few. Saddle is in fact the foremost of horse accessories to occur to you, it being an integral part of horse riding. It provides rider a support structure on the back of the horse for a safe and enjoyable ride.

Corrective pads, also known as saddle pad, is a must have if your horse sweats a lot or feels uncomfortable with just the saddle on its back. A Numnah or corrective pad under the saddle serves the purpose of saddle blanket. It absorbs excess sweat and diminishes uncomfortable rubbing of saddle against the skin of your horse. It should be thicker than a normal saddle blanket and may consist of multiple layers, consisting of felt, foam and other warming materials ending in a soft cover at the innermost layer that would come in direct contact with the horses skin. It is also beneficial for your horse as a corrective pad. It also saves your horse from chronic backache, which is otherwise a common feature among pet ridden horses.
